Introduction
At Cedar advertisements, we have been a Leading digital promoting company situated in San Francisco, California, presenting major-tier promoting options that empower firms to ascertain a solid on the https://maesqga957319.blogaritma.com/32050395/cedar-adverts-top-digital-online-company-in-california